Monozygotic Twin Pairs (MZ)
Identical twins that result from a single fertilized egg splitting, sharing the same genetic material.
Concordance
Concordance refers to the degree of similarity in the presence of a certain trait or condition, especially in twins, indicating the role of genetic factors.
Genetic Basis
the underlying genetic makeup that contributes to the physical and physiological traits or the likelihood of developing certain conditions.
